Output 7661c918627504390ed6257bec5889eceb82107af18275d6c73404fe60172d41:6
- value
- 530000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6857787892703830d32053e6eb6cc10c67b54457 OP_EQUAL
- address
- 3BCiz4GpLhvPLebqfvtN8gd7Fo8LCMPYse
- transaction
- 7661c918627504390ed6257bec5889eceb82107af18275d6c73404fe60172d41
- confirmations
- 502628
- spent
- true